In the vibrant tapestry of poetry, few figures shine as brightly as John Keats, whose verses resonate like echoes of a time when words held the weight of eternity. A Brighter Word Than Bright: Keats at Work, penned by Dan Beachy-Quick, stands as a remarkable homage to the intricacies of Keats's poetic universe, inviting readers to immerse themselves in the shimmering depths of creativity and the fervor of artistic labor.

This isn't merely an exploration of Keats's oeuvre; it is a profound dissection of the very act of writing. Beachy-Quick intricately weaves personal reflections with analytical interpretations, creating a rich dialogue not just about what Keats wrote, but how he navigated the turbulent waters of inspiration and doubt. The pages overflow with contemplation about creation, weaving the mundane with the sublime, urging you to grasp the transformative power of poetry itself.

What truly captivates is how Beachy-Quick doesn't just recount events or reveal facts; he immerses you in the emotional landscape of Keats's life, showcasing the poet not as a distant figure, but as a fervent soul grappling with the demons of his art. Feel the gnawing tension between aspiration and vulnerability that Keats lived through, and experience how his struggles gave birth to some of the most exquisite poetry ever penned. It's a journey of heartbreak, passion, and raw humanity that beckons you to reflect on your own creative endeavors.

Readers rave and sometimes debate the nuances within Beachy-Quick's interpretations, with some heralding his insights as groundbreaking while others contest his conclusions. This dichotomy only highlights the complexity of literature itself and the myriad interpretations it inspires. The exploration of Keats's correspondence and his deep connections with his contemporaries, such as Shelley and Byron, pulls readers into a rich historical context, enkindling a desire to understand not just the man, but the world that shaped him.
